MOUNT VERNON — L. Wayne Meekins, 91, of Mount Vernon died Thursday, Nov. 5, 2009, at Riverside Methodist Hospital in Columbus.
He was born in Knox County on Nov. 22, 1917, a son of the late James and Effie (Bailey) Meekins. Wayne was a graduate of Fredericktown High School and lived and worked his entire lifetime in Knox County. Wayne retired in 1981 from the Mount Vernon Water Treatment Plant after 25 years of faithful service.
Wayne is survived by his devoted wife of over 27 years, Marie (Street) Meekins; a son, Dennis (Bonnie) Meekins of Mount Vernon; a daughter, Norma Jean (David) Gee of Ridgecrest, Calif.; two daughters-in-law, Beverly Meekins of Fredericktown and Rosemary Henley of Lagrange, Ky.; two stepdaughters, Kimberly Stiltner of Columbus and Judy N. Harper of Grove City; 16 grandchildren; 14 great-grandchildren; and three great-great-grandchildren.
In addition to his parents, Wayne was preceded in death by his first wife and the mother of his children, Evelyn (Burdine) Meekins; sons, Gerald Meekins and Gordon Henley; stepson, Stuart Harper; a brother, Kenneth Meekins; and a sister, Irene Cutler.
